Proactively, some hematologists now offer interferon-based therapy to very young, asymptomatic low-risk PV patients. The rationale is to leverage the drug's potential for disease modification by reducing JAK2 allele burden early on, even though this is not yet a formal guideline-supported indication.

Despite impressive data supporting HMA/Venetoclax, its application in younger, fit patients must be cautious. The pivotal VIALE-A trial excluded key subgroups like FLT3, core binding factor, and certain NPM1 patients, for whom intensive chemotherapy remains the standard.

A new clinical trial is evaluating selinexor, a non-JAK inhibitor, as a first-line therapy in myelofibrosis, with a JAK inhibitor added later only if needed. This innovative sequencing challenges the current, long-standing paradigm of initiating all treatments with a JAK inhibitor.

For young or hesitant low-risk PV patients, framing the initiation of cytoreductive therapy as a temporary trial, rather than a lifelong commitment, can ease anxiety. This approach allows patients and physicians to assess symptomatic benefits without the pressure of a permanent decision.

Interferon can take 6-8 months to achieve a complete hematologic response. To manage patients during this period and avoid frequent phlebotomies, clinicians can prescribe a short, overlapping course of faster-acting hydroxyurea, providing immediate control while transitioning to the long-term therapy.

Unlike in CML where treatment-free remission is an established goal, discontinuing interferon in PV after a deep molecular response is considered theoretical and experimental. Clinicians caution against setting this as an expectation for patients, as most will require indefinite therapy to maintain control.

The development of agents targeting specific mutations like CALR and JAK2V617F marks a move away from the "one size fits all" JAK inhibitor approach. This enables a more personalized, molecularly-driven treatment strategy that was previously not possible for MPN patients.

Interferon therapy is being evaluated in a distinct niche from JAK inhibitors. It is targeted at patients with early or low-risk myelofibrosis, not for immediate symptom control, but with the strategic goal of potentially modifying the disease course and slowing its natural progression.

Despite label recommendations for rapid dose escalation of ropeginterferon, experienced clinicians advocate for a slower, more patient-centric approach. This prioritizes long-term tolerability and adherence, which is crucial for achieving disease modification, over achieving rapid hematologic control.

A patient's risk score primarily determines their candidacy for a stem cell transplant. However, the decision to start a JAK inhibitor is driven by symptoms like splenomegaly and constitutional issues, regardless of the patient's formal risk status. This decouples two key treatment decisions.

While standard guidelines dictate treating only symptomatic CLL, some patients experience debilitating anxiety from 'watch and wait.' In rare cases, clinicians may initiate therapy primarily to improve quality of life by removing this significant psychological stress.
